IP Groups

The IP group type is represented in the tree by the IP icon
. A master IP group is comprised of sub-group members
and/or individual IP members .
The global administrator adds master IP groups, adds and
maintains override accounts at the global level, and estab-
lishes and maintains the minimum filtering level.
The group administrator of a master IP group adds sub-
group and individual IP members, override account, time
profiles and exception URLs, and maintains filtering profiles
of all members in the master IP group.
